Output 75c2ca62b9ddfaba06de4be795823b4bf7d2061721957aedceadef0ea8fbf9f8:68

value
1011266
script pubkey
OP_0 OP_PUSHBYTES_20 343ac0319a5603ff732905e277893ea2d60d64f4
address
bc1qxsavqvv62cpl7uefqh380zf75ttq6e85cr82vc
transaction
75c2ca62b9ddfaba06de4be795823b4bf7d2061721957aedceadef0ea8fbf9f8
spent
true